Scholars add to a degree of sporting success on campus
UNIVERSITY SPORT
TOP student athletes from around the world have joined Team Newcastle to help cement it as one of the best performance sport universities in the UK.
Following its Top 10 BUCS ranking in 2016/17 (its seventh in 11 years), Newcastle welcomed 148 sports scholars who will compete across 18 different sports.
This is a record number of sports scholars for the university, representing a 20% increase on last year’s intake.
Colin Blackburn, Director of Sport at Newcastle University, said: “The highest-ever number of Sports Scholarships and applications reflects not only the standard of applications we received but also the increased support of the university, Santander, Sir Robert McAlpine and Reeves Independent Wealth Management. Our sports scholarship programme enables high-performing student athletes to fulfil both their sporting and academic potential.
“It is about excellence and is aimed at ensuring our student athletes maximise both their sporting and academic potential at Newcastle.”
Sports Scholarships are awarded on an annual basis and are available to undergraduate and postgraduate applicants, as well as current students.
Team Newcastle has 94 new and 54 continuing sports scholars.
All scholars have access to the Scholar Workshop Programme covering topics including sports psychology and performance analysis.
